Get started169 Carr House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Doncaster (DN4 5DP). It has a recorded floor area of 118 m² (around 1270 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2025)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in February 2009 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.
Untraded for 30 years, with the last transfer in December 1995.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£186,000 sits 558.4% above the 1995 sale of £28,250.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£22/sq ft) was about 72.5% below the postcode norm.
